On Tue, 27 Sep 2016, Ondrej Zary wrote:

> Convert g_NCR5380 to use scsi_add_host instead of scsi_module.c
> Use pnp_driver and isa_driver to manage cards.
> 
> In order to support multiple cards, new module parameter format is
> introduced. The old parameters are kept for compatibility.

> @@ -28,6 +28,16 @@ time. More info to come in the future.
>  This driver works as a module.
>  When included as a module, parameters can be passed on the insmod/modprobe
>  command line:
> +  irq=xx[,...]       the interrupt(s)
> +  base=xx[,...]      the port or base address(es) (for port or memory 
> mapped, resp.)
> +  card=xx[,...]      card type(s):
> +             0 = NCR5380,
> +             1 = NCR53C400,
> +             2 = NCR53C400A,
> +             3 = Domex Technology Corp 3181E (DTC3181E)
> +             4 = Hewlett Packard C2502
> +
> +These old-style parameters can support only one card:
>    ncr_irq=xx   the interrupt
>    ncr_addr=xx  the port or base address (for port or memory
>                 mapped, resp.)
> @@ -36,11 +46,19 @@ command line:
>    ncr_53c400a=1 to set up for a NCR53C400A board
>    dtc_3181e=1  to set up for a Domex Technology Corp 3181E board
>    hp_c2502=1   to set up for a Hewlett Packard C2502 board
> +
>  e.g.
> -modprobe g_NCR5380 ncr_irq=5 ncr_addr=0x350 ncr_5380=1
> +OLD: modprobe g_NCR5380 ncr_irq=5 ncr_addr=0x350 ncr_5380=1
> +NEW: modprobe g_NCR5380 irq=5 base=0x350 card=0
>    for a port mapped NCR5380 board or
> -modprobe g_NCR5380 ncr_irq=255 ncr_addr=0xc8000 ncr_53c400=1
> -  for a memory mapped NCR53C400 board with interrupts disabled.
> +
> +OLD: modprobe g_NCR5380 ncr_irq=255 ncr_addr=0xc8000 ncr_53c400=1
> +NEW: modprobe g_NCR5380 irq=255 base=0xc8000 card=1
> +  for a memory mapped NCR53C400 board with interrupts disabled or
> +
> +NEW: modprobe g_NCR5380 irq=0,7 base=0x240,0x300 card=3,4
> +  for two cards: DTC3181 (in non-PnP mode) at 0x240 with no IRQ
> +             and HP C2502 at 0x300 with IRQ 7
>  
>  (255 should be specified for no or DMA interrupt, 254 to autoprobe for an 
>       IRQ line if overridden on the command line.)
